  Traditional Chinese medicine and Western medicine are different. The most difficult part of Western medicine is diagnosis, once the diagnosis is clear, the treatment method is fixed, which makes it easy to hold someone accountable. However, traditional Chinese medicine is different, for the same disease, there may be many different diagnostic results, leading to many different treatment methods, so the risk of accidents is also very high. Once an accident occurs, people will develop a rejection of traditional Chinese medicine.

  The same is true for traditional Chinese medicine, Western medicine also has fake drugs, but most of the time, Western medicine has trademarks and anti-counterfeiting marks, so the market for fake drugs will not be large, and it's easy to spot them. However, this is not the case with traditional Chinese medicine, as most of the herbs are sold loose, people almost have no ability to distinguish between real and fake herbs, which is a huge obstacle to the promotion of traditional Chinese medicine. It is imperative to introduce a modernized system for traditional Chinese medical treatment and popularize TCM theories among the masses.
